Multipliers Profiles

Multipliers in the context of KCOA are people, institutions and organisations that enable and amplify the dissemination and application of information or knowledge products in organic agriculture and agroecology.

Most characteristically, multipliers disseminate knowledge that is in line with the principles of organic agriculture as defined by IFOAM.

They are people, institutions and organisations that enable and amplify the dissemination and application of information or knowledge products and they do so by compiling organic and agroecological knowledge, collected and developed together with their communities and according to local needs. 

Multipliers may include actors and decision makers of civil society, private sector and governmental structures, such as:

Rural Service Providers (RSPs); innovators (youth, women and men) incl. innovative farms; model farmers; trainers; extension agents; opinion leaders; champions; policy makers; development partners; organisations and entrepreneurs / private sector actors / value chain operators that provide services with respect to organic and agroecological farming / processing / marketing practices to farms and other actors along value chains; organic and agroecological agriculture training and education initiatives/institutes; farmer organisations; NGOs in service of communities (incl. faith based organisations); consumer organisations; and many more.
